Under the Sea Learning Outcomes

Sea Project Term Overview Students will:
  • Understand that the ocean floor consist of various living and non-living things.
  • Comprehend that sea animals vary in characteristics that make them different from one another.
  • Some water animals provide food for us such as: lobsters, crabs, shrimp, clams, etc.
  • Some water animals can be kept in aquariums as pets (ex. fish, frogs, snails, etc).
  • Identify characteristics and habitats of ocean life.
  • Interpret and locate information using research and literature about the ocean.
  • Compare and contrast ocean life.
  • Participate in and complete activities using multimedia tools on the ocean life theme.
  • Use critical thinking by generalizing the information learned about ocean life with today's world.
  • Classify sea life animals and become familiar with different kinds of sea life.
  • Listen to and read different books on sea life.
  • Create a Kid PIX illustration of their favorite sea creature
